- the present invention relates to a device for fixing a glazing or similar surface against the frame of a framing support, in particular metallic and more especially, albeit not exclusively, made of aluminum profile.
- the classic solution consists, at the same time that the glass is properly centered in its support by placing suitable seat wedges between the glass and the return of the frame. and on which the edge of the glass rests, to have between the bottom of the frame and the internal part of the glass a putty or similar bonding material, generally based on silicone which fixes these two elements together.
- the present invention relates to a fixing device which avoids these drawbacks by allowing efficient and safe bonding of flat surfaces, in particular glass, on a framing support, whatever the shape or nature of the surface coating of metallic or other elements. which constitute this support.
- the device according to the invention for fixing a flat surface, in particular made of glass, on a framing support, comprising, mounted against the support facing the flat surface to be fixed, a bonding profile having a face parallel to the surface, is characterized in that the face is applied against the flat surface with the interposition of a putty, the characteristics of which are defined beforehand to be exactly adapted to those of the profile and to those of the flat surface, allowing their mutual connection, the bonding profile being immobilized in an open groove formed in the hollow in the framing support.
- the invention therefore consists in avoiding all the drawbacks which result from a possible incompatibility between a determined putty and a profile constituting the part of the framing support against which a flat glass or other surface must be glued, by inserting the place of bonding an appropriate profile, metallic or possibly of another kind which has a precise surface condition for which the putty used is also suitable.
- the invention therefore makes it possible to ensure the bonding between the glass and this profile by overcoming the particular characteristics of the framing support, the latter being only provided with means making it possible to mechanically fix the bonding profile in appropriate places which thus becomes integral with the support and ensures the connection with the glass surface under conditions always equal to themselves.
- the bonding profile has a rectangular section with an open lateral groove in which engages at least one raised rib carried by the support to immobilize the profile in the groove thereof.
- the bonding profile has a dovetail or other section.
- the flat surface and the framing support delimit beyond the putty interposed in line with the bonding profile a space reserved for a filling material to keep the putty facing the profile.
- the flat surface is mounted in its support frame by means of the seat wedges arranged in the bottom of the support, a seal being housed between the glass and the end of the support, towards the outside thereof.
- the mastic consists of an adhesive product, in particular a structural silicone, the characteristics of which are adapted according to the invention to the nature of the bonding profile itself, consisting a metallic element, in particular an aluminum, composite material or other suitable material.
- the bonding profile is made of the same material as that of the planar surface, for example glass.
- the invention thus has the advantage of very rapid assembly and adaptation, whatever the structure and the nature of the surface coating of the profiles which constitute the framing support.
- the provision in the latter of the groove intended to receive the bonding profile can be easily envisaged in the manufacture of these profiles without causing a significant increase. ficatif their cost price.
- the installation of the bonding profile is very easy and made all the more easy since this profile is not visible from the outside once the glazing has been placed in its support.
- the reference 1 designates the entire device according to the invention in a first embodiment.
- This device is in particular intended to ensure the mounting and fixing of a flat glass surface 2 inside a framing support 3.
- the surface 2 consists of two thicknesses of parallel glass respectively 4 and 5 delimiting between them a space 6, the spacing between the two parallel glass surfaces being maintained by spacers 7.
- the framing support 3 is produced in the form of a metal profile, in particular of an aluminum profile and has a vertical part 8 substantially parallel to the surface of the glazing 2 and a peripheral edge 9 perpendicular to the part 8 and externally surrounding the glazing. Reinforcements such as 10 and 11 are advantageously arranged outwards on the part 8 and the edge 9.
- the glazing 2 is mounted in its frame support 3 with interposition of seat wedges 12 suitably distributed.
- a seal 15 is advantageously mounted towards the outer end of the edge 9 around the glazing 2.
- connection is made between the glazing 2 and the framing support 3 by the putty 13, by fitting the part 8 with a shaped part 16 which came directly during the manufacture of the corresponding profile to thus define a groove 17 open towards the glazing 2.
- a bonding profile 18 in particular metallic but which could possibly be of another nature, this profile being anchored inside the groove 17 by ribs 19 and 20 respectively provided in the profile and which penetrate into grooves of the same section of the profile.
- the profile 18 has an external surface 21 which is preferably flush with the outside while lying in the extension of the part 8 and against which the bonding putty 13 is bonded.
- This surface 21 has exactly determined characteristics, chosen according to of the nature of the adhesive sealant which can therefore, whatever the state or surface coating of the framing support, ensure in all circumstances the gluing of the glazing against the support under exactly determined conditions.
- FIG 1 there is schematically shown a barrier 22 attached to the front of the framing support against the glazing, this barrier however having only a decorative or sealing role but not participating by itself to the connection exclusively produced by the putty and the bonding profile 18.
- Figure 2 illustrates another alternative embodiment where the bonding profile 18a mounted in the groove 17 here has a dovetail shape thus avoiding the anchoring ribs provided in the variant of Figure 1 where the groove and the profile that it receives have a general rectangular section.
- the invention is not limited to a particular material both for the bonding profile itself and for the putty used, which however is generally a product based on silicone.
